Lermon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Lermon Come From? nationality or country of origin

Lermon (Russian: Лермон) is found in The United States more than any other country/territory. It can also occur in the variant forms:. For other potential spellings of this last name click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Lermon? popularity and diffusion

Lermon is the 1,453,389th most frequent surname in the world It is held by approximately 1 in 49,575,142 people. It is primarily found in The Americas, where 87 percent of Lermon reside; 85 percent reside in North America and 85 percent reside in Anglo-North America. Lermon is also the 1,430,306th most common given name globally It is held by 49 people.

It is most numerous in The United States, where it is held by 120 people, or 1 in 3,020,491. In The United States it is most frequent in: Texas, where 48 percent reside, Minnesota, where 28 percent reside and Georgia, where 7 percent reside. Aside from The United States Lermon occurs in 13 countries. It is also found in Russia, where 4 percent reside and Canada, where 3 percent reside.

Lermon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Lermon has changed over time. In The United States the number of people bearing the Lermon last name rose 2,000 percent between 1880 and 2014.

Lermon Last Name Statistics demography

The religious adherence of those bearing the Lermon last name is primarily Presbyterian (67%) in Ireland.

In The United States those holding the Lermon surname are 46.09% more likely to be registered Republicans than The US average, with 92.86% being registered to vote for the party.

Lermon earn marginally less than the average income. In United States they earn 4.86% less than the national average, earning $41,054 USD per year.
